Morning Links: Dr. Phil says sorry again
Dr. Phil says he regrets talking about Britney Spears and her mental state, after visiting her in the hospital, but still insists he didn't violate the family's trust. Dr. Phil was on "Good Morning America" this morning and told Diane Sawyer: "I don't think it helped the situation. I don't think it hurt the situation. ... I hope and pray that Britney will get help and that her life will be used as a great lesson for young stars that come in behind her." He still insists that he was personally asked by Lynne Spears to come and try to help her daughter.

Angelina Jolie and Brad Pitt had people talking at the Screen Actors Guild Awards show on Sunday about whether Jolie is pregnant with the couple's second child. Us Magazine "confirms" the pregnancy, and says Jolie may sell the official announcement, with proceeds to go to a charity. The couple also sold pictures of newborn Shiloh to People, and donated the money to charity.

Jake Gyllenhaal is taking the death of Brokeback Mountain co-star Heath Ledger badly, according to People. Since Ledger's death, Gyllenhaal has been said to be pretty distant on the set of his new movie "Brothers," caught up in his thoughts and staring into space. The People source says that the two of them were "very close" and that the sudden death "had a strong personal effect" on Gyllenhaal, who is also the godfather to Ledger's two-year old daughter Matilda.
